What's Happening?
The recent launch of China's Moonshot AI's Kimi K3 model has caused a stir in global tech markets, leading to a selloff in semiconductor and Chinese AI stocks. The Kimi K3 model, known for its low cost and high capabilities, is seen as a potential challenge
to Western AI technologies. Despite initial market concerns, some analysts argue that the fears are misplaced and that the model's efficiency could benefit the broader AI industry. Shares of major tech companies like Alphabet, Microsoft, and Amazon have seen slight increases in premarket trading, recovering from previous losses triggered by the Kimi K3 launch.
